Games for Windows Live 3.5.89.0
The official Windows Live online gaming store
- Available on Softag servers
- Free Download
- Free virus
Software information
- OS: Windows
- License: Freeware
- Category: Game Utilities
- Size: 627.65 KB
- Developer: Microsoft
- Updated: 30/01/2022